About Rachel Sutherland

Rachel Sutherland is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, General Health Professions, Physiology, Speech and Hearing and Developmental and Educational Psychology, having authored 150 papers that have together received 4.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(56 papers), Health Policy Implementation Science (18 papers), Physical Activity and Health (13 papers), Mobile Health and mHealth Applications (7 papers), School Health and Nursing Education (7 papers), Children's Physical and Motor Development (6 papers), Nutritional Studies and Diet (4 papers) and Consumer Attitudes and Food Labeling (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health (1.4k citations), General Health Professions (890 citations), Physical Therapy, Sports Therapy and Rehabilitation (166 citations), Developmental and Educational Psychology (446 citations) and Applied Psychology (130 citations). Rachel Sutherland has collaborated with scholars based in Australia, Canada and United States. Frequent co-authors include Luke Wolfenden, Nicole Nathan, John Wiggers, Sze Lin Yoong, David R. Lubans, Rebecca Wyse, Elizabeth Campbell, Alix Hall, Philip J. Morgan and Rebecca K Hodder. Their work appears in journals such as International Journal of Behavioral Nutrition and Physical Activity, Journal of Medical Internet Research, Health Promotion Journal of Australia, Implementation Science and Cochrane Database of Systematic Reviews.
